What is required when applying for a license transfer?

Explanation:
When applying for a license transfer, you must follow a formal process: notify the licensing authority, have the application reviewed by that authority, and obtain their approval for the transfer before it can take effect. This sequence ensures the transferee meets all qualifications, the location and business plan comply with the rules, and there are no outstanding issues that could affect public safety or compliance. Verbal notice alone doesn’t create a formal record or initiate the official review, so it’s insufficient. There isn’t an automatic transfer just because ownership changes—the license must go through the authority’s review and receive explicit approval. And while transfers are allowed, they’re only valid once the proper approval is granted.
